**Vendor note: Inkmill markdown pipeline**

Rendering for Parchway docs is outsourced to Inkmill under an annual contract, renewing each March. They handle sanitization and PDF export; we own the upload queue. SLA: 4-hour response on rendering failures. Escalate only after two failed retries. Their support desk is reachable at the address below.

billing contact of hahaf-baguf = zorael.tammir.jorius@sivrelhq.internal

The Lanternfall parity dashboard tracks feature gaps between our Swift and Kotlin SDKs for the Harborwick messaging platform. Normal access goes through standard SSO. If SSO is down and you need the dashboard during an incident — typically to confirm whether a client bug is parity-related — use the break-glass path. This bypasses the Duskmere identity provider entirely and is logged to the audit channel. File an incident note within one hour of use. The break-glass login accepts the following recovery passphrase.

unlock words, tagaf-hahif: ralwyn-lammir-rusax-sormir

Meeting notes — Operations, Monday

Topic: Uniform shipment for the new Garrowfen depot.

Eighty uniform sets packed in four cartons, sized and labelled per the roster from HR. Delivery via Marquist Freight, expected Wednesday. Receiving site to verify carton count against the packing slip. At courier hand-over, follow the confidential instruction below.

handover note for kageg-bajog: the fenion zorael courier leaves the wenax eliath wenix druvan eliion ulawyn kelys quenax ledger at gate 1070 under passcode 936556